Output 062b258ea33d3e38b25075d96dba1fc85e0c8a92eb9a478e9350247cb7e85434:2

value
778398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af81c28f31fa1bc8b9faf868a8aba6c4f4122f75 OP_EQUAL
address
3Hh1czmMofs4iXbWyANSY1MWrDrZEyzApd
transaction
062b258ea33d3e38b25075d96dba1fc85e0c8a92eb9a478e9350247cb7e85434
spent
true